Things I Think You Should Keep in Mind
Even though I had a positive experience, I think it is important to be realistic. If you often wash very greasy pans or dishes with dried-on food, you may need to use a bit more gel or rinse items before loading them. I also think results can vary depending on water hardness and dishwasher settings, so I paid attention to how my machine performed with it.
